Taula de continguts:

Raspberry Pi PhotoBooth: HTML5 i NodeJS: 4 passos
Raspberry Pi PhotoBooth: HTML5 i NodeJS: 4 passos

Vídeo: Raspberry Pi PhotoBooth: HTML5 i NodeJS: 4 passos

Vídeo: Raspberry Pi PhotoBooth: HTML5 i NodeJS: 4 passos
Vídeo: Raspberry Pi PhotoBooth 2024, Desembre
Anonim
Image
Image

Un fotobot HTML5 i NodeJS amb previsualització en directe i vores personalitzades.

Aquest projecte va començar com una cosa que vaig construir per al ball de l'escola de la meva filla. Volia alguna cosa divertida perquè ella i els seus amics recordessin l’esdeveniment (que era l’última vegada que estarien tots junts a la seva escola). Es va convertir en una descarada promoció per a l’empresa on treballo (on esperava que els clients visitants utilitzessin el fotobot per documentar la seva visita a la nostra oficina). Si us plau, descarregueu-ho i proveu-ho vosaltres mateixos.

Es pot trobar més informació a https://github.com/raymondljones/photobooth/wiki Això suposa que teniu un Raspberry Pi dedicat a aquest projecte. Un cop configurat l'AP WiFi, el Pi deixarà de tenir accés a Internet tret que estigui connectat a través d'Ethernet. Nota: heu de tenir una pantalla d'algun tipus connectada al Pi. I s'ha de configurar per arrencar a la interfície gràfica d'usuari no sense cap. Després de configurar el Pi (amb o sense pantalla tàctil) i connectar la càmera web mitjançant USB. Només heu de seguir les instruccions. Després de la instal·lació: la instal·lació ràpida s'encarregarà de les dependències necessàries (nodejs, php, crom, etc.), a més de configurar el quiosc del navegador de crom i el punt d'accés Wifi. Un cop reiniciat el pi, el punt d'accés Wifi estarà disponible mitjançant SSID: Contrasenya PhotoBooth: photoboothpass El Pi hauria d'arrencar a la pantalla completa del quiosc de crom (el primer llançament requereix que permeti l'accés a la càmera) … Qualsevol ordinador de la xarxa PhotoBooth pot visiteu també https://192.168.100.1/booth.html (assegureu-vos d'utilitzar https) per convertir-vos en un PhotoBooth addicional a la xarxa (sempre que hi hagi una càmera connectada). A més, qualsevol ordinador de la xarxa PhotoBooth també pot visitar https://192.168.100.1/booth.html (deixar com a http). Aquesta pàgina us permetrà accedir a totes les fotos preses (us permetrà imprimir o suprimir). Per afegir les vostres pròpies vores, només podeu editar booth.html que es troba a / var / www / html /, buscar les etiquetes `li` que contenen les imatges de vores (opció-1.png, opció-2.png, etc.). Afegiu les vostres etiquetes "li", mantenint únic l'atribut data-option. Utilitzeu una de les vores proporcionades a / var / www / html / images com a guia de mida.

Subministraments

  1. Raspberry Pi
  2. Qualsevol càmera web USB (no una Rpi Cam oficial)
  3. Una pantalla tàctil o qualsevol pantalla del Pi

Pas 1: descarregueu-ho des de Github

Baixeu-vos el projecte @ https://github.com/raymondljones/photobooth en un directori que trieu.

Pas 2: descomprimiu

Descomprimiu-lo (si es descarrega com a zip) i aneu al directori del projecte mitjançant la línia d'ordres: `cd project`

Pas 3: Augmenteu els vostres permisos

Converteix-te en root: `sudo bash`

Pas 4: executeu l'instal·lador ràpid

Executeu aquesta ordre `sh quick-install.sh`

Recomanat: